Rock Choir ‘flash mob’ perform musical treat for unsuspecting Harpur Centre shoppers

Bedford Rock Choir assembled in the Harpur Centre on Saturday (13 May) to give unsuspecting passers-by and shoppers an impromptu musical treat.

Choir members came from all directions, bursting into a surprise ‘flash mob’ rendition of Boogie Wonderland. They then performed a one-hour set for the gathered audience.

Bedford Rock Choir has been chosen to open this summer’s West End Proms, which is being held in Bedford Park on Sunday 25 June and their performance promises a spectacular opening set of uplifting, feel-good, pop, rock and chart songs.

Rock Choir is a nationwide initiative and was the first contemporary choir of its kind to offer an accessible and inclusive experience for amateur singers. 

With over 33,000 members in over 400 local communities, Rock Choir is an alternative to the traditional classical or community choir, with its ethos of fun, friendship and community spirit being a huge part of the attraction.

Members of Bedford Rock Choir told the Bedford Independent that being part of Saturday’s flash mob was a “wonderful” and “uplifting” experience.

“I joined Rock Choir in January and have found it to be a warm and inclusive group with a common goal to have fun whilst singing,” said one of the singers.

“Rob [Baker, Rock Leader] is an energetic leader who encourages us to learn and perform with confidence.  It is truly joyous!”

Another member of the choir told us how many of their long-held ambitions had been fulfilled by being part of Rock Choir.

“Rock Choir has given me the chance to fulfil some long-standing ambitions including singing solo to a paying audience, singing at Disneyland Paris and recording at Abbey Road,” they said.

“Being selected to sing at the Bedford West End Proms is a terrific finale to my year with Rock Choir.”

Bedford Rock Choir is led by Rock Leader Rob Baker and they rehearse on a Wednesday night and Thursday morning at Kings House in Bedford.
